Haragan

Haragan is a village located in the Rayagada Subdivision of Rayagada district,Odisha, India. Haragan has a population of 36 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Gumma Gram Panchayat and the Rayagada Block Panchayat in Rayagada District. The village has 8 households and is identified by village code 426301. Haragan is located in the 765002 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Rayagada Sub-District.

Total Population of Haragan

As of the 2011 census, Population of Haragan has a population of approximately 36 people, where the male population is 17 and the female population is 19.

Total 36
Male 17
Female 19
